Your link checker can't see your JavaScript.

A dead-link sweep over built HTML read '0 dead' while real clicks 307-redirected. The navigations were client-side location.assign() calls a checker never parses out of dist/.

We run a dead-link sweep over the built site. It walks every file in dist/, pulls out every href and src, and checks that each internal target resolves to a real page and not a redirect. Our config sets trailingSlash: "always", so the host serves /app/new/ as a 200 and 307-redirects the bare /app/new. The sweep is there to catch exactly that — a link written without its trailing slash that costs every clicker a redirect round-trip. For a long time it read a clean 0 dead / 0 redirecting, and we believed it.

Then we watched a real session. A visitor clicked the composer's CTA and the network tab showed a 307 before the page they wanted. The sweep still said zero. It wasn't wrong about what it looked at — it just couldn't see the link, because the link wasn't a link.

A checker reads attributes. A React island navigates in JavaScript.

The CTA didn't ship as an <a href> pointing at /app/new/. It shipped as a click handler inside a React island — a location.assign(…) call whose string argument was the bare path /app/new. After the bundler is done, that target is a string argument to a function call, buried in a minified chunk. There is no href attribute anywhere in the built HTML for a checker to parse — the navigation only exists at runtime, when the handler fires. A tool that greps dist/ for href/src is structurally blind to it. Same story for a bare location.href assignment in an Astro <script>, or a window.open.

So the redirect was invisible in exactly the place we'd promised ourselves it couldn't hide. ConnectForm.tsx's /app?db= navigation 307-redirected on every click while the dashboard row read 0 redirecting. This is the dangerous shape of a bug: not a red test, but a green checkmark over a question the checker was never able to ask.

The built-output sweep had a second hole: it never ran in CI

There was a worse version of the same blind spot. The sweep runs on built output, so it only fires when something builds the site — a manual run, or the daily job. It was never wired into CI on the pull request. So a plain static href to /terms — a link the checker could see — sat 307-redirecting for two days, because nothing built the site on the PR that introduced it. A guard that only runs after merge is a guard that reports history, not one that blocks a regression.

Move the check to the source, and spend the effort on the false positives

The fix is to stop parsing built HTML and start reading source, as a fast unit test that runs on every PR. The naive version — grep the src/ tree for location.assign — drowns in false positives: route matchers, new URL(location.href) reads, prose in comments, asset URLs like /og.png that legitimately carry no slash. A guard that cries wolf gets suppressed, and a suppressed guard is no guard. The whole game is a match narrow enough to be false-positive-free.

// Match ONLY the string-literal target of an actual client navigation:
//   location.assign("…")  |  .replace("…")  |  location.href = "…"
// bare or window.-prefixed; one optional helper hop so
//   location.assign(attachHandoff("/dashboard/")) still gets swept.
const NAV =
  /\blocation(?:\.href\s*=|\.(?:assign|replace)\s*\()\s*(?:\w+\(\s*)?["'`]([^"'`]*)["'`]/g;

// Then, for each captured path, flag the ones that will redirect:
function offends(url) {
  if (!url.startsWith("/") || url.startsWith("//")) return false; // relative / cross-origin
  const path = url.split(/[?#]/)[0];
  if (path.endsWith("/")) return false;              // already correct
  if (path.split("/").pop().includes(".")) return false; // /og.png — an asset, not a page
  return true;
}

The narrowness is the design, not an accident. Matching the location member (.assign/.replace/.href =) rather than a loose call means an aliased or .bind-ed reference can't duck the sweep, and neither member is ever read for anything but navigating. Dropping the trailing-slash rule for a final segment with a dot skips real assets. Skipping .test.ts files means the one place that documents the call shape — the test itself — doesn't trip it. The result matches the handful of navigations that genuinely redirect and nothing else, so a failure names the file, the line, and the offending path.

What carries over

  1. A checker only guards what it can parse. A link-checker over built HTML sees href/src attributes and nothing else. Every client-side navigation — location.assign, location.href =, window.open, a <meta refresh> — is invisible to it. Name that blind spot out loud, because the tool will keep reporting a confident zero across it.
  2. A guard that runs after merge reports history. The built-output sweep was real but only fired on a post-merge build, so a redirect it could see still shipped. Wire the invariant into the check that runs on the pull request, or it is documentation of past regressions, not prevention of new ones.
  3. Move the invariant to the cheapest layer that can see it. The fact you care about — every internal navigation carries its trailing slash — is decidable from source. A source-level unit test runs in milliseconds on every PR, with no build and no browser, and it can see the JavaScript the HTML sweep never could.
  4. A narrow true-positive beats a broad noisy one. The broad source scan was rejected because it false-positived on route matchers and asset URLs; a guard people mute is worse than none. Match the exact shape that redirects — the string-literal argument of a real navigation — and nothing else.
